MJP Associates's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, MJP Associates held 267 positions worth $799M, up 5.3% from $760M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 59% of the portfolio.

MJP Associates's Q4 2025 filing shows 15 new, 126 increased, 94 reduced and 21 closed positions. Its largest new stake was PIMCO Multi Sector Bond Active ETF: 415,813 shares worth $11.1M. The largest sale was iShares Russell 1000 Value ETF, an estimated $36M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 13% of assets, down from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Communication Services.
